Понимание энергосберегающего веб-дизайна
Современные тенденции в веб-разработке всё чаще направлены на создание не только функциональных и привлекательных сайтов, но и экологически устойчивых проектов. В этом контексте энергосберегающий веб-дизайн выступает как необходимый инструмент для снижения углеродного следа цифровых продуктов.
Энергосбережение в веб-дизайне заключается в оптимизации ресурсов, задействованных при отображении и работе сайта, что напрямую влияет на потребление электроэнергии как сервером, так и конечным устройством пользователя. Такая оптимизация способствует не только улучшению пользовательского опыта, но и сокращению негативного воздействия на окружающую среду.
Для понимания, как именно можно добиться энергосбережения, следует учитывать параметры загрузки, сложность визуальных и интерактивных элементов, а также архитектуру сайта и качество кода. Это позволяет разработчикам и дизайнерам создавать устойчивые проекты, отвечающие современным стандартам экологии и эффективности.
Основные принципы энергосберегающего веб-дизайна
Первым ключевым принципом является минимизация веса страниц – уменьшение объема передаваемых данных. Это достигается посредством сжатия изображений, кода и отказа от избыточных графических эффектов.
Второй важный аспект – оптимизация и рациональное использование ресурсов. Энергоэффективный дизайн подразумевает использование простых, но выразительных визуальных решений, отказ от чрезмерной анимации и элементов, требующих высокой вычислительной мощности устройств.
Третий принцип – адаптивность и прогрессивное улучшение. Сайт должен корректно работать на различных устройствах и в условиях ограниченной пропускной способности сети, что также положительно сказывается на общем энергопотреблении.
Минимализм и простота интерфейса
Минималистичный дизайн не только облегчает загрузку страницы, но и снижает нагрузку на процессор и графический адаптер. Простые формы, ограниченная цветовая палитра и отказ от сложных текстур позволяют значительно снизить энергозатраты при отображении.
Использование типографики вместо графики для передачи информации также сокращает количество данных и ресурсы, необходимые для отрисовки, что положительно влияет на энергопотребление.
Оптимизация изображений и медиа
Изображения часто занимают большую часть объема страницы, поэтому их компрессия и правильный выбор форматов (например, WebP вместо JPEG или PNG) значительно уменьшают время загрузки и потребление энергии.
Кроме того, важно применять отложенную загрузку (lazy loading), когда медиаэлементы подгружаются только при необходимости, что снижает начальную нагрузку на систему и экономит ресурс.
Технологические методы снижения энергопотребления
Использование современных технологий и стандартов существенно влияет на энергопотребление веб-сайтов. Примерами таких решений являются применение эффективных форматов данных, оптимизация кода и применение серверных практик, направленных на экономию ресурсов.
Правильная архитектура кода и применение нативных возможностей браузеров позволяют снизить избыточность и обеспечить плавную работу интерфейса при минимальном расходе энергии.
Код и производительность
Оптимизация HTML, CSS и JavaScript напрямую влияет на время загрузки и работу сайта. Чистый и хорошо структурированный код снижает вычислительные затраты устройств, повышая скорость отклика и снижая энергопотребление.
Динамическое подгружение компонентов, использование кеширования и минимизация количества запросов к серверу также способствуют снижению общей нагрузки на систему.
Выбор хостинга и серверной инфраструктуры
Экологичный веб-дизайн не ограничивается фронтендом. Выбор энергоэффективного хостинга и серверов с использованием возобновляемых источников энергии является ключевым в сокращении углеродного следа проекта.
Использование CDN (Content Delivery Network) для распределения контента позволяет снизить нагрузку на отдельные серверы и улучшить скорость доставки данных, что уменьшает энергозатраты по всему маршруту передачи.
Практические рекомендации по созданию энергосберегающих веб-дизайнов
Для достижения действительно эффективных результатов в создании энергоэффективных сайтов, важно сочетать теоретические знания с практическими методами и инструментами, ориентированными на устойчивое развитие.
Ниже приведён список ключевых рекомендаций, способствующих экономии энергии при разработке веб-проектов.
- Используйте современные форматы изображений и видео с эффективным сжатием.
- Применяйте ленивую загрузку для тяжелых элементов страницы.
- Минимизируйте количество HTTP-запросов и объединяйте файлы CSS и JS.
- Сокращайте использование тяжелых анимаций и эффектов.
- Оптимизируйте код, избегая избыточных циклов и библиотек с избыточным функционалом.
- Выбирайте экологически ответственный хостинг и используйте CDN.
- Тестируйте производительность при различных условиях сети и устройствах.
- Предоставляйте пользователям опции для выбора “ночного” или темного режима, что экономит энергию на OLED-дисплеях.
Инструменты и метрики анализа энергоэффективности
Существуют специализированные инструменты, позволяющие оценить энергопотребление сайтов и выявить узкие места в плане оптимизации. Они помогают разработчикам контролировать влияние своих решений на устойчивость проекта.
Примерами таких инструментов могут служить анализаторы производительности и инструменты для измерения числа запросов и объема передаваемых данных, что связано с энергозатратами при работе сайта.
Влияние энергосберегающего дизайна на бизнес и общество
Устойчивые веб-проекты имеют большое значение не только для экологии, но и для бизнес-стратегий. Энергосбережение напрямую влияет на скорость загрузки и удобство использования сайта, что позитивно сказывается на удержании посетителей и конверсии.
С точки зрения общественной ответственности, компании демонстрируют свою приверженность экологическим стандартам, укрепляя доверие и лояльность пользователей. Это становится важным конкурентным преимуществом на современном рынке.
Экономия затрат и улучшение имиджа
Сокращение потребления ресурсов ведет к уменьшению расходов на хостинг и техническое обслуживание сайта. При этом улучшение пользовательского опыта способствует росту показателей удовлетворенности и взаимодействия с брендом.
Энергосберегающий подход способствует формированию позитивного имиджа компании, что важно в эпоху повышенного внимания к вопросам устойчивого развития и экологии.
Вклад в глобальную устойчивость
Цифровая экосистема становится все более значимой частью мирового энергопотребления. Ответственный веб-дизайн способствует снижению общего воздействия индустрии информационных технологий на климат и окружающую среду.
Каждый шаг в сторону оптимизации и устойчивого развития оказывает мультипликативный эффект, способствуя построению более экологичной цифровой инфраструктуры.
Заключение
Создание энергосберегающих веб-дизайнов — это комплексная задача, включающая в себя оптимизацию визуальных элементов, кода и серверной инфраструктуры. Такой подход обеспечивает снижение энергопотребления как на стороне пользователя, так и на сервере, уменьшая углеродный след цифрового продукта.
Внедрение принципов минимализма, использование эффективных форматов, грамотное проектирование интерфейса и выбор экологичного хостинга являются основными инструментами для достижения целей устойчивого веб-дизайна.
В итоге, энергосберегающий дизайн не только повышает производительность и удобство проектов, но и вносит значительный вклад в защиту окружающей среды, формируя позитивный имидж компаний и поддерживая глобальные инициативы по устойчивому развитию.
Что такое энергосберегающий веб-дизайн и почему он важен для устойчивых проектов?
Энергосберегающий веб-дизайн — это подход к созданию сайтов и приложений, который минимизирует потребление электроэнергии как на стороне сервера, так и на стороне пользователя. Это достигается за счёт оптимизации кода, уменьшения объёмов передаваемых данных и сокращения нагрузок на устройства. Такой дизайн важен для устойчивых проектов, поскольку снижает углеродный след цифровых продуктов, поддерживает экологическую ответственность компании и способствует более эффективному использованию ресурсов.
Какие ключевые техники помогут снизить энергопотребление веб-сайта?
Среди наиболее эффективных техник можно выделить: минимизацию и сжатие файлов CSS, JavaScript и изображений; использование современных форматов изображений (например, WebP); кэширование ресурсов на стороне клиента; отказ от избыточной анимации и тяжелых визуальных эффектов; выбор простых и быстро загружаемых шрифтов; а также оптимизация серверной инфраструктуры с использованием энергоэффективных хостингов.
Как адаптация дизайна под «тёмный режим» влияет на энергопотребление?
Тёмный режим уменьшает яркость экрана, что особенно заметно на устройствах с OLED и AMOLED-дисплеями, где пиксели отображаются индивидуально и чёрные участки не потребляют энергию вовсе. Внедрение тёмного режима в веб-дизайн может значительно снизить энергопотребление на стороне пользователя, повысить комфорт восприятия и тем самым способствовать более экологичному использованию веб-ресурсов.
Какие инструменты помогут измерить и улучшить энергосбережение веб-ресурса?
Для оценки энергоэффективности сайта можно использовать инструменты, такие как Google Lighthouse, который анализирует производительность и позволяет выявить излишне тяжёлые элементы. Кроме того, сервисы вроде Website Carbon Calculator измеряют приблизительный углеродный след веб-сайта. На основе этих данных можно оптимизировать структуру, сократить объёмы данных и улучшить время загрузки, что положительно скажется на энергопотреблении.
Как вовлекать пользователей в практики энергосберегающего веб-дизайна?
Можно информировать пользователей о преимуществах энергосберегающего дизайна через специальные подсвечивающие элементы или всплывающие подсказки, предлагать включать тёмный режим или экономичный режим загрузки. Прозрачность в отношении экологии и устойчивого развития повышает лояльность аудитории и мотивирует пользователей поддерживать более экологичные технологии во взаимодействии с вашим сайтом.